Benefits of a Watch for Your Child

A watch isn’t just a fashionable accessory for your youngster. It also delivers several key benefits. Understanding these benefits can help guide you to the right watch for your child.

Telling Time

Perhaps the most obvious benefit of wearing a watch is teaching your child to tell time. Digital clocks on smartphones and appliances seem to outnumber more traditional analog styles these days, which means your child needs to learn how to tell time two ways: digital and analog. Investing in a kids watch offers an opportunity to learn about telling time, especially when that daily time telling is paired with some at-home lessons. This concept is typically introduced in elementary school, so you can use the watch to introduce this concept ahead of schedule or to reinforce school-based lessons at home.

Time Management

Once your child gets the basics of time telling down, they can use the watch to begin to learn the concept of time and develop time management skills. Initially, your child might not have much of an understanding of what a half-hour is compared to an hour. Ten minutes might sound likely plenty of time to a young child––until they learn that it isn’t. Having a watch introduces these basic concepts because they can follow how time progresses on their watch.

Even more, a watch helps your child learn how to manage this time. By elementary school, your child can start to identify how to schedule and best use their time. They can process the concept of having a certain amount of time to complete various tasks, such as completing homework and enjoying outdoor play time. They can then begin to determine how to appropriately manage that time to tackle each task. Having a watch on the wrist makes time management easier.

Technology Skills

Since many of today’s watches are smartwatches, these watches can also help develop your child’s technology skills. Your kid can learn to work with a touchscreen interface, which is something that they will likely use in the classroom or at home in years to come. These watches can introduce them to digital calendar applications and teach them how to capture photos with built-in cameras. Some smartwatches allow users to upload photos and videos onto their computer, giving kids an opportunity to develop that skill as well. All of these skills extend beyond just smartwatch use, allowing you to create a tech savvy kid.

Evaluating Kids Watch Options

When you’re shopping for a kids watch, you’ll be choosing from three different types: analog, digital, or smartwatch. There isn’t a one-size-fits-all option for every kid, so learn about the different styles to choose the appropriate watch for your child’s needs.

Analog 

An analog watch is the most traditional and basic style, as well as the one that you can use to teach kids how to tell time in the traditional way. Many of these kids watches are built with features that encourage time telling, including easy-to-read numbers and labeled watch hands. Assess what features your child needs depending on their current time-telling abilities because some are developed for beginners and some for kids who know how to tell time.

Digital

Digital styles offer a new time-telling opportunity and are a good choice for kids who already know how to read an analog watch. Many of these styles include other time-related features as well, including timers, alarms, and stopwatches, which offer additional opportunities to understand time concepts. Plus, digital styles are designed for sporty, active kids, with some offering convenient waterproof designs.

Smart

Smartwatches offer a variety of watch faces, including both analog and digital. Kids can toggle between styles, giving them the opportunity to learn beyond basic time telling. These watches include an array of other features, including time-management tools like calendars and alarms. They’re packed with entertainment options too, including cameras and games. These watches aren’t just for time telling––they’re truly an entertainment tool for your youngster.

How to Choose the Best Kids Watch

With so many watch styles available, choosing the right kids watch requires some serious contemplation. Shop with your child’s age and skill level in mind. Consider these key features when selecting a watch for your child.

Purpose 

Decide whether you want your child to learn to tell time on an analog or digital style. Alternatively, you can invest in a smartwatch, which offers both options along with other built-in features.

Durability

Consider how your child will use the watch to determine how durable it needs to be. If your child is active and athletic, for example, a durable watch is a must. On the other hand, if your child plans to simply wear the watch as a fashion statement, you don’t necessarily need a style that’s designed for durability. Signs of a durable watch include a silicone band, stainless steel hardware, and a waterproof or water-resistant design.

Age

Your child’s age plays a factor in choosing the right watch. While all watches are adjustable and can fit different wrist sizes, be sure to check age guidelines to ensure you find one that is an appropriate fit. Elementary-aged children and older will be more adept at using a smartwatch or than toddlers and preschoolers, who may benefit from simpler styles.

VTech KidiZoom Smart Watch

The VTech KidiZoom Smart Watch is a touchscreen smart watch with 256MB memory. It’s packed with features that kids will love, offering many features beyond just telling time. But, let’s start there. This watch includes 55 digital and analog watch faces, allowing your child to mix up the watch design every day. Other time-telling features include a stopwatch and alarm, which can help instill some responsibility in your youngster. Use the alarm feature to alert your child that it’s time for dinner, time to turn off the TV, time to go to bed, or time to wake up.

This VTech Smart Watch can also encourage your youngster to stay active, thanks to a pedometer and built-in activity challenges that will keep their feet moving. The watch also includes dual cameras, with one at the top of the watch and one on the side. As a result, your kid can snap pictures of family, friends, and their favorite things, as well as shoot selfies. This camera can even take short videos for added fun. The camera includes photo and video effects, allowing kids to capture silly selfies using kid-friendly filters.

Kids also have the option to play five games, including Monster Catcher and Noodle Booster, with the option to download more. While kids might love having games strapped to their wrist all day, parents might be less than enthused by this constant access to potentially distracting games. As a result, don’t expect to send your kids to school in this smartwatch. 

The VTech KidiZoom Smart Watch is rechargeable and comes with a micro-USB cable. Connect this cable to any USB port to charge it or to your computer’s USB port to download photos and videos.

Timex Time Machines Watch

This Timex Time Machines Watch is the perfect starter watch for kids ready to learn to tell time, which is why it gets our vote for Best Analog Watch. This watch features an easy-to-read white dial with large Arabic numerals. The clock face includes all 12 hours, as well as numbers at the 5-minute marks. On some styles, the hour and minute hands are labeled as well, a feature that serves as a useful guide for kids who are still learning how to tell time.

This watch has garnered quite a few awards, including the Creative Child Awards Product of the Year Award and Tillywig Brainchild Award––for good reason. The Time Machines Watch comes in an array of colors. Themed designs feature sea animals, sharks, sports like soccer and basketball, camouflage, and dinosaurs. Some watch dials are accented by rotating characters that move with the watch hands.

The wristband features an elastic strap and comes in a variety of colors and patterns, making it simple to find one your kid will love. While the idea behind the buckle-free wristband is that kids can put it on themselves, some kids may have trouble tightening it effectively using the metal slide. This watch fits up to a 6-inch wrist circumference. Plus, the strap can be removed and popped in the washing machine if your little one is tough on it––like most kids are.
